Diagnostic Description
provided by Fishbase
Lesser size of black spot at caudal base which is brownish and a reduced in size of lateral spots (fourth Gambetta's pigmentary zone). Mouth arched with three pairs of very short barbels. Males with developed lamina circularis.

Morphology
provided by Fishbase
Dorsal spines (total): 3; Dorsal soft rays (total): 7; Analspines: 2 - 3; Analsoft rays: 5

Biology
provided by Fishbase
Found in rivers. Oviparous, possibly with distinct pairing during breeding similar to congeners (Ref. 205).
